Life style : Dreams of Pregnancy and Their Significance

Dream before Pregnancy
      The Lisu people believe that dreaming is a way of communicating. Dreams are significant and there are explanations to certain dreams especially for women. Lisu people believe that if a woman dreamed of herself conceived in her dream, it means that she is really pregnant. The woman will normally be able to remember the dream.
Dreams during Pregnancy
      If Lisu women have dreams during pregnancy, some of these dreams may have certain meaning to their lives. Some of these dreams would be able to inform pregnant Lisu women of the sex of their unborn child. For example, if they dream about going hunting for animals or going for a battle, it would mean that her child is most probably a male. In another case, if the woman dreams of working in a farm and collect fruits and vegetables, her child is probably a female. If Lisu woman dreams of herself collecting rotten fruits, it would mean that her child is retarded and abnormal. These are some of the superstitious believes of Lisu people.

      There are signs to show if the unborn baby can be born healthily or unsuccessfully. If the Lisu mother dreams of herself vomiting, crying or passing out blood as urine, it would mean to Lisu people that the fetus is dead. If the Lisu woman dreams of a baby coming to say goodbye or the baby walks towards an endless road, it will mean that the baby is leaving the mother and he/she is dead. The Lisu people believe that whether the baby is healthy or not depends on the deeds of his/her parents. If the parents did a lot of sins, the Lisu people will feel that the baby will receive all the punishments for his/her parents and born abnormally.
